Примерные вопросы на зачете
1. Дайте определение реляционной База Данных? Роль системы управления базами данными (СУБД) в организации.
2. Архитектура современных СУБД. В чем суть логического и инфологического моделирования?
3. Этапы проектирования СУБД. Каковы принципы построения ER-модели?
4. Нормализация БД. В чем особенности первой, второй и третей нормальной формы?
5. Какие задачи по проектированию БД могут решаться с помощью инструментальных средств ErWin/BpWin.
6. Каково назначение языков DDL и DML. Как создать таблицу БД используя DDL.
7. Какие существуют операторы языка SQL для чтения и записи данных?
8. Какие существуют операторы языка SQL для обновления (редактирования) и удаления данных?
9. Какие существуют операторы языка SQL предоставления прав доступа к отдельным объектам БД различным пользователям?
10. В чем отличия архитектуры клиент-сервер от архитектуры файл-сервер? Каковы особенности работы БД в многопользовательском режиме?
11. Роль интерфейсов ODBC и ADO в проектах разработки приложений баз данных под Windows?
12. Какие основные функции языка программирования PHP используются для организации доступа к объектам СУБД MySQL Server в WEB-приложениях.
13. Как осуществить доступ к БД из приложений под Windows, используя VBA и ADO.
14. Опишите основные этапы проектирования приложений БД под WEB. Как осуществить передачу данных с WEB-страницы серверу БД?
15. Перечислите функции администратора БД. Как осуществить физический перенос объектов БД c данными между различными серверам (например, в MS SQL Server).
16. Перечислите основные инструментальные средства инструментальные средства СУБД MS SQL Server?
17. Каково предназначение инструментального средства инструментального средства служб Reporting Services?
18. Каково назначение оператора BULK INSERT в Transact SQL?
19. Каково назначение функций – указателей в Transact SQL?
20. Перечислите основные инструментальные средства инструментальные средства СУБД Oracle?
21. Какие функции управления данными могут быть реализованы с помощью Oracle enterprise manager?
22. Из каких ключевых блоков состоит программа PL/SQL?
23. Как осуществить запрос нескольких строк из базы данных, используя курсоры PL/SQL?
24. Какие задачи, связанные с проектирование СУБД MySQL Server могут быть выполнены с помощью программы EMS SQL Manager for MySQL?
Тематика заданий по различным формам текущего контроля